2020 ILS to QAR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2020

During 2020, the ILS to QAR ex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on December 31, valuing the pair at 1.1333.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on March 17, dropping to 0.9484.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 0.1849 QAR.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 1.0523 to the December average rate of 1.1222, the exchange rate registered a net change of 6.64% (reflecting a strengthening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2020 high of 1.1333 was up 7.51% compared to the 2019 peak of 1.0541,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.

Monthly Breakdown

Statistical summary for each calendar month.

Month High Low Average
January 1.0558 1.0481 1.0523
February 1.0687 1.0427 1.0603
March 1.0579 0.9484 1.0150
April 1.0468 0.9983 1.0205
May 1.0408 1.0268 1.0354
June 1.0628 1.0418 1.0539
July 1.0697 1.0532 1.0610
August 1.0848 1.0655 1.0717
September 1.0851 1.0461 1.0635
October 1.0789 1.0615 1.0729
November 1.1015 1.0668 1.0840
December 1.1333 1.1069 1.1222
